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work
Feeling unsure what to say? That’s normal — the trick is to keep it low-pressure and specific. Start with a short, adaptable opener that invites a reply instead of demanding a life story.
- Profile hook: Pick one small detail from their profile and ask a curious, open question. Example: “I noticed you like hiking — what’s one trail you’d recommend for someone who prefers views over steep climbs?”
- Two-choice prompt: Give an easy decision to respond to. Example: “Coffee or tea for a slow Sunday morning?” or “Board games or movie night?”
- Observation + light callback: Mention something specific and add a playful follow-up. Example: “That photo with the vintage camera caught my eye — do you have a favorite era of photography?”
- Shared-interest starter: If you both like the same band, show curiosity, not expertise. Example: “I see you’re into [band]. Which song of theirs is an instant replay for you?”
- Mini challenge: Offer a tiny, fun task that’s easy to answer. Example: “Describe your ideal weekend in three words.”
How to avoid sounding bland or pushy:
- Skip generic lines like “Hey” or “How are you?” alone — add one detail so your message feels personal.
- Avoid excessive flattery or intense questions on the first message; save deeper topics for later conversations.
- Don’t copy-paste long monologues. Short, targeted messages are easier to reply to and feel more genuine.
Quick structure to follow: 1) a specific detail, 2) a light question or choice, 3) one-line personal touch. Example template: “Saw you like [detail] — curious, what do you enjoy most about it?” Change the tone to playful, curious, or casual depending on the profile.
Final tip: If they reply, mirror their energy and match question length — that keeps the exchange comfortable and gives you more to build on. Small, thoughtful openers often lead to better conversations than perfect lines.
